What Are the Best Protective Phone Cases?

From screen protection to rugged materials, here’s everything you need to consider before purchasing your next phone case.

Material: Rubber provides a nice grip that’s not too thick, while leather can absorb some serious impact. If you know you’ll be around water or hazardous chemicals, a fully enclosed case is a must, as is a case made with materials that can stand up to intense damage.

Raised Bezel: A case that protrudes a few millimeters beyond your screen is significant too, for when your phone falls face-first onto a hard surface, and prevents it from directly hitting the flat floor. For phones with curved screens though, this design can block out some of the perimeter display, so be sure to go for a case that’s made with the sides in mind.

Overheating: If you’re putting your phone through intense strain, such as charging it up from zero while using a heavy, battery-draining app, a case that’s a littletoo insulating may cause the phone to shut down as a precautionary measure to prevent damage.

Fit: A snug case all-around can help prevent dirt, sand, moisture and pocket debris from creeping in between the case and the phone, or into the phone itself. Always go for a case that’s specifically designed for your phone, even if you think it’ll still fit. The main reason: Some cases can affect phone features like GPS and Qi wireless charging, interfering with the necessary signals, or worse, covering up important ports or camera lenses.
